To streamline the logistics process within the counting centres of Kuehne+Nagel and Statiegeld Nederland, Tible developed the Handheld Terminal App. This Android application serves as the crucial link between floor operations and Tible’s HAWK-DRS software and ensures that deposit bags are not lost, both within the logistics chain and within the IT system.

The client

Kuehne+Nagel manages the logistics and counting of return packaging such as PET bottles and cans in their counting centres on behalf of the national deposit system in the Netherlands.

Challenge

Manually registering shipments and managing loading documents in counting centres was error-prone and time-consuming. Operators had no real-time system to register truck loads, scan bags, and document discrepancies, which led to operational mistakes and loss of traceability in the process.

Approach

Tible developed an Android-based Handheld Terminal App that enables operators to:

  • Operator login via unique batch codes printed on-site.
  • Receive and confirm shipment orders based on loading documents.
  • Systematically scan bags with labels specifying type and category.
  • Report discrepancies immediately with comment functions for documentation.
  • Real-time synchronization with the HAWK-DRS system for full traceability.

Result

With the HHT app, Kuehne+Nagel has achieved a streamlined registration process that minimises operational errors and ensures full accountability. Operators can now efficiently process shipments, trace bags, and document discrepancies, while the system ensures that no bag is lost in the process.
